### Changelog — Haulmark fuel-usage report, default changes (v5.1)

For security review: the fleet fuel-usage report now aggregates per depot rather than per driver by default, reducing exposure of individual movement patterns. Export retention was shortened, and anonymous access to historical summaries was disabled. No data schema changed; only defaults moved. The reporting service now starts with the following configuration.

deployment values, yadug-bawif:
[framir]
team = pelox
access_code = ac_a38ab2
owner = tamion.julael
host = framir.tolvaqlabs.test
port = 11211
peer = tammir.zemvargrid.local
salt = 2215ef03
pin = 1541

## Ticket: Staging env misconfigured for locker access flow

The Tumblecrest laundry-locker staging environment was pointing at the production door-controller bridge, so test unlock requests briefly triggered real lockers at the Pinemarsh pilot site. For future maintainers: always verify LOCKER_BRIDGE_URL targets the staging bridge before running the access-flow suite. The staging bridge also requires its own credential, distinct from production, which belongs on the line below:

sealed setting: ARCHIVE_KEY3=8d0

The old polling loop is gone; workers now consume from named channels with acked delivery. Retry semantics changed — we get at-least-once instead of best-effort, so I added idempotency keys to the three non-idempotent handlers. Dead-letter routing is configured but the alerting hook is stubbed, flagged with a TODO. When reviewing, focus on the handler changes. The migration rationale and rollback plan are documented on the page below.

dashboard of tawef-hagug = https://superset.norvadyn.local/display/projects/build/ticket/build/spaces/ticket/1e989f0e6c200d20fc4ae06b